ETHYLARSINE
- CAS NO.:593-59-9
- Empirical Formula: C2H7As
- Molecular Weight: 106
- SAFETY DATA SHEET (SDS)
- Update Date: 2023-04-23 13:52:06
Properties of ETHYLARSINE
Boiling point: | 36°C |
Density | 1.2140 |
Water Solubility | 0.13g/L(19 ºC) |
